High-Performance 10G Ethernet with 100G Uplinks
The NETGEAR M4350-16V4C AV Line Managed Switch offers 16 dedicated 10G Ethernet ports, providing ample bandwidth for connecting a range of AV-over-IP devices such as media servers, encoders, and decoders. The switch also includes 4 100G QSFP28 uplink ports, delivering ultra-fast backbone connectivity for high-capacity, real-time AV networks. This ensures smooth and uninterrupted media transmission even in the most demanding AV environments, such as large venues, broadcast studios, and enterprise AV systems.
Optimized for AV-over-IP Performance
Designed for AV-over-IP applications, the M4350-16V4C features advanced IGMP Snooping and Multicast routing, which efficiently manages the distribution of AV streams across multiple endpoints without overloading the network. The non-blocking architecture allows all ports to operate at full speed, preventing any bottlenecks and ensuring low-latency performance. This is critical for real-time AV applications such as video walls, live event production, and digital signage, where any delay in data delivery can impact performance.
Advanced Layer 2 and Layer 3 Networking Features
With support for both Layer 2 and Layer 3 switching, the M4350-16V4C offers advanced features for greater network flexibility and scalability. Layer 2 functionalities such as VLANs, QoS (Quality of Service), and Spanning Tree Protocol (STP) allow network segmentation and prioritization of AV traffic. Layer 3 capabilities, including dynamic routing protocols like OSPF, RIP, and VRRP, ensure efficient traffic management and high availability across larger, complex AV networks. This flexibility makes the switch suitable for a variety of AV installations, from small setups to large, multi-location networks.

Modular and Stackable Design for Network Scalability
The M4350-16V4C is part of NETGEAR’s modular M4350 series, allowing multiple switches to be stacked together to increase port density and expand network capacity. This modular approach simplifies network management by allowing all stacked switches to be managed as a single unit. The stackable design makes the switch a future-proof solution, enabling easy network expansion as more AV devices are added or as system requirements evolve over time.
